Breed Information: Australian Kelpie and Dutch Shepherd Mix The Australian Kelpie is renowned for its intelligence, agility, and loyalty, while the Dutch Shepherd is known for its versatility, friendliness, and strong work ethic. Mrs. Perla inherits these wonderful traits, making her a smart, adaptable, and loving companion. Both breeds are energetic and thrive on regular mental and physical stimulation. They are known for their trainability and ability to form strong bonds with their families, making them excellent pets for active households.
